Abstract :
A simple generalized approach, based on numerical evaluation of the Fourier coefficients, is presented to evaluate the comprehensive performance of three-phase phase-controlled thyristor ac voltage controllers. Three-phase balanced resistive and inductive loads of different power factors are considered. The method of solution adopted is simple, accurate, fast, and does not require the derivation of Fourier coefficient equations. Various electrical properties are compared graphically for the different circuit configurations. The branch-controlled deltaconnected load is considered to have the best performance, giving the highest power factor per unit of power delivered.
